howler-client


Namehowler-client JSON
Version 1.6.0.dev15944 PyPI version JSON
download
home_pagehttps://github.com/CybercentreCanada/howler-client
SummaryHowler Client Python Library
upload_time2023-11-23 15:21:24
maintainerAnalysis Support
docs_urlNone
authorAnalysis Support
requires_python
licenseMIT
keywords development howler client gc canada cse-cst cse cst
VCS
bugtrack_url
requirements No requirements were recorded.
Travis-CI No Travis.
coveralls test coverage No coveralls.
            **Le version français suit**

# Howler Client Library

The Howler client library facilitates issuing requests to Howler.

## Running the Tests

1. Prepare the howler-api:
    1. Start dependencies
    1. `howler-api > python howler/app.py`
    1. `howler-api > python howler/odm/random_data.py`
2. Run Java integration tests:
    1. `howler-client > mvn verify`
3. Run python integration tests:
    1. `howler-client/python > python -m venv env`
    1. `howler-client/python > . env/bin/activate`
    1. `howler-client/python > pip install -r requirements.txt`
    1. `howler-client/python > pip install -r test/requirements.txt`
    1. `howler-client/python > pip install -e .`
    1. `howler-client/python > pytest -s -v test`


======

# Français

# Bibliothèque client de Howler

La bibliothèque client Howler facilite l'émission de requêtes à Howler.

## Exécution des tests

1. Préparez l'interface howler-api :
    1. Démarrer les dépendances
    1. `howler-api > python howler/app.py`
    1. `howler-api > python howler/odm/random_data.py`
2. Exécutez les tests d'intégration Java :
    1. `howler-client > mvn verify`
3. Exécuter les tests d'intégration python :
    1. `howler-client/python > python -m venv env`
    1. `howler-client/python > . env/bin/activate`
    1. `howler-client/python > pip install -r requirements.txt`
    1. `howler-client/python > pip install -r test/requirements.txt`
    1. `howler-client/python > pip install -e .`
    1. `howler-client/python > pytest -s -v test`

            

Raw data

            {
    "_id": null,
    "home_page": "https://github.com/CybercentreCanada/howler-client",
    "name": "howler-client",
    "maintainer": "Analysis Support",
    "docs_url": null,
    "requires_python": "",
    "maintainer_email": "analysis-development@cyber.gc.ca",
    "keywords": "development howler client gc canada cse-cst cse cst",
    "author": "Analysis Support",
    "author_email": "analysis-development@cyber.gc.ca",
    "download_url": "",
    "platform": null,
    "description": "**Le version fran\u00e7ais suit**\n\n# Howler Client Library\n\nThe Howler client library facilitates issuing requests to Howler.\n\n## Running the Tests\n\n1. Prepare the howler-api:\n    1. Start dependencies\n    1. `howler-api > python howler/app.py`\n    1. `howler-api > python howler/odm/random_data.py`\n2. Run Java integration tests:\n    1. `howler-client > mvn verify`\n3. Run python integration tests:\n    1. `howler-client/python > python -m venv env`\n    1. `howler-client/python > . env/bin/activate`\n    1. `howler-client/python > pip install -r requirements.txt`\n    1. `howler-client/python > pip install -r test/requirements.txt`\n    1. `howler-client/python > pip install -e .`\n    1. `howler-client/python > pytest -s -v test`\n\n\n======\n\n# Fran\u00e7ais\n\n# Biblioth\u00e8que client de Howler\n\nLa biblioth\u00e8que client Howler facilite l'\u00e9mission de requ\u00eates \u00e0 Howler.\n\n## Ex\u00e9cution des tests\n\n1. Pr\u00e9parez l'interface howler-api :\n    1. D\u00e9marrer les d\u00e9pendances\n    1. `howler-api > python howler/app.py`\n    1. `howler-api > python howler/odm/random_data.py`\n2. Ex\u00e9cutez les tests d'int\u00e9gration Java :\n    1. `howler-client > mvn verify`\n3. Ex\u00e9cuter les tests d'int\u00e9gration python :\n    1. `howler-client/python > python -m venv env`\n    1. `howler-client/python > . env/bin/activate`\n    1. `howler-client/python > pip install -r requirements.txt`\n    1. `howler-client/python > pip install -r test/requirements.txt`\n    1. `howler-client/python > pip install -e .`\n    1. `howler-client/python > pytest -s -v test`\n",
    "bugtrack_url": null,
    "license": "MIT",
    "summary": "Howler Client Python Library",
    "version": "1.6.0.dev15944",
    "project_urls": {
        "Homepage": "https://github.com/CybercentreCanada/howler-client"
    },
    "split_keywords": [
        "development",
        "howler",
        "client",
        "gc",
        "canada",
        "cse-cst",
        "cse",
        "cst"
    ],
    "urls": [
        {
            "comment_text": "",
            "digests": {
                "blake2b_256": "3d3cfa66aa90b88ab0a63271ae71a8b29fa095b0131eb0b51cf0412aacdaea09",
                "md5": "5c8d3f71404bfe00dce766849efe3fcc",
                "sha256": "4e2e7d9a16f824de390a8080ff09afdbbcc6db1eebb1e7797aa9f56f9b4b3bd9"
            },
            "downloads": -1,
            "filename": "howler_client-1.6.0.dev15944-py2.py3-none-any.whl",
            "has_sig": false,
            "md5_digest": "5c8d3f71404bfe00dce766849efe3fcc",
            "packagetype": "bdist_wheel",
            "python_version": "py2.py3",
            "requires_python": null,
            "size": 19980,
            "upload_time": "2023-11-23T15:21:24",
            "upload_time_iso_8601": "2023-11-23T15:21:24.292839Z",
            "url": "https://files.pythonhosted.org/packages/3d/3c/fa66aa90b88ab0a63271ae71a8b29fa095b0131eb0b51cf0412aacdaea09/howler_client-1.6.0.dev15944-py2.py3-none-any.whl",
            "yanked": false,
            "yanked_reason": null
        }
    ],
    "upload_time": "2023-11-23 15:21:24",
    "github": true,
    "gitlab": false,
    "bitbucket": false,
    "codeberg": false,
    "github_user": "CybercentreCanada",
    "github_project": "howler-client",
    "github_not_found": true,
    "lcname": "howler-client"
}
        
Elapsed time: 3.52011s